Fighting between Azerbaijan and Armenia entered the fourth day on Wednesday. The biggest eruption of the decades-old conflict since a 1994 ceasefire. Nagorno-Karabakh is a disputed region inside Azerbaijan and controlled by ethnic Armenians.
